Recap: St. Louis 3, Wild 2

Last update: November 2, 2007 - 12:14 AM

STAR TRIBUNE'S THREE STARS

1. Manny Legace, St. Louis: He stopped all nine third-period Wild shots, mostly bona fide scoring chances.

2. Jay McKee, St. Louis: Scored the winning goal, blocked three shots and drew a penalty to turn the momentum.

3. Marian Gaborik, Wild: Ended a six-game goalless drought, his longest stretch since 2003-04, and had an assist.

BY THE NUMBERS

10 Goals by Pavol Demitra in nine games against St. Louis, his former team.

6 Consecutive games the Wild has allowed a power-play goal, one shy of the team record.
